Elected by the shareholders, the Capcom's board of directors comprises two types of representatives: Capcom inside directors who are chosen from within the company, and outside directors, selected externally and held independent of Capcom. The board's role is to monitor Capcom's management team and ensure that shareholders' interests are well served. Capcom's inside directors are responsible for reviewing and approving budgets prepared by upper management to implement core corporate initiatives and projects. On the other hand, Capcom's outside directors are responsible for providing unbiased perspectives on the board's policies.
